Sun and Moon Data for One Day
The following information is provided for Holden, Johnson County, Missouri (longitude W94.0, latitude N38.7):

Sunday
18 December 2005 Central Standard Time

SUN
Begin civil twilight 6:59 a.m.
Sunrise 7:29 a.m.
Sun transit 12:13 p.m.
Sunset 4:57 p.m.
End civil twilight 5:26 p.m.

MOON
Moonrise 6:40 p.m. on preceding day
Moon transit 2:28 a.m.
Moonset 10:09 a.m.
Moonrise 7:42 p.m.
Moonset 10:41 a.m. on following day


Phase of the Moon on 18 December: waning gibbous with 91% of the Moon's visible disk illuminated.

Full Moon on 15 December 2005 at 10:16 a.m. Central Standard Time.
